Alan Kyerematen resigned at the wrong time - Dr Nyaho-Tamakloe


Politics of Tuesday, 31 March 2026Source: www.ghanaweb.comA founding member of the New Patriotic Party (NPP), Dr Nyaho Nyaho-Tamakloe has said that the former Minister of Trade and Industry, Alan Kyerematen, missed key critical opportunities in his political career by resigning from the party at a wrong time. Speaking to GhanaWeb's Etsey Atisu on The Lowdown, he argued that Kyerematen should have resigned much earlier, particularly during the period when the Akufo-Addo administration faced a corruption scandal. “Alan Kyerematen resigned at the wrong time. I think it was way too late; very too late.”Alan Kyerematen first resigned from the NPP on April 17, 2008, following his loss in the 2007 NPP flagbearership race. “In 2007, I joined a distinguished group of seventeen (17) presidential aspirants to contest in the presidential primaries of NPP.
